The ISO4 abbreviation of Frontiers in Molecular Biosciences is Front. Mol. Biosci. . It is the standardised abbreviation to be used for abstracting, indexing and referencing purposes and meets all criteria of the ISO 4 standard for abbreviating names of scientific journals. The Department of Molecular Biosciences at the University of Kansas is an excellent environment for research and education. The department offers Doctor of Philosophy and Master of Science graduate degrees in Biochemistry and Biophysics, in Molecular, Cellular, and Developmental Biology , and in Microbiology.
